Negative statements are the opposite of affirmative statements. In English, there are several ways to create negative statements.
affirmative | negative |
She is hungry. | She is not hungry. |
I have friends at work. | I have no friends at work. |
There are some over there. | There are none over there. |
Tom always walks to school. | Tom never walks to school. |
Somebody is here. | Nobody is here. |
Something happened. | Nothing happened. |
Both parents have arrived. | Neither parent has arrived. |
Tom and Sue have left. | Neither Tom nor Sue has left. |
We’re happy and pleased. | We’re unhappy and displeased. |
